RIPOL received Qualisteelcoat certification covering CorroCare ABP anticorrosion Primer

RIPOL is proud to announce that Qualisteelcoat has given certification covering Anticorrosion powder coating primers of its Series CorroCare ABP.

  • CorroCare ABP STEEL PRIMER for Steel Structures, mechanically pretreated – Dual-layer System – Corrosion C4-H– Qualisteel coat License n° PE-064
  • CorroCare ABP STEEL PRIMER for Steel Structures, chemically pretreated – Dual-layer System – Corrosion C4-H– Qualisteel coat License n° PE-065
  • CorroCare ABP HDG PRIMER for Hot Dip Galvanized Structures, mechanically pretreated – Dual-layer System – Corrosion C5-I– Qualisteel coat License n° PE-072
